Example 1: A man married a woman when he was thirty-three and she was twenty-seven. This could indicate a second marriage for both of them in some areas of the United States. On the other hand, if there was a thirteen-year-old child in the family with the father's last name, it might be an indication of the father's previous marriage.

Example 2: The death of anyone on the eastern seaboard of the United States between 1860-1865 could indicate possible Civil War involvement or causes.

Example 3: The disappearance of an 18 to 30 year old ancestor in the eastern states before the 1850 census, with no death record located, could indicate a visit to the California gold mining industry.

Example 4: Someone who was born in Tennessee, who married in Ohio, and who died in California in 1863 might also have been involved with the California Gold Rush.

Example 5:Upon studying the dates it was noticed that the great grandfather is only 30 years older than the grandson. Perhaps someone has added a generation to the family because two grandparents had the same names.
